Bendrinti naudojant


Ryšio nuorodos naudojimas sprendime su Microsoft Dataverse

Jungtis yra tarpinis serveris arba apvyniojimas aplink API, leidžiantis pagrindinei paslaugai kalbėtis su Microsoft Power Automate Microsoft Power Apps "Azure Logic Apps" ir "Azure Logic Apps". Tai suteikia galimybę vartotojams prijungti savo paskyras ir naudoti iš anksto sukurtų veiksmų ir paleidiklių rinkinį programoms ir darbo eigoms kurti.

Ryšys yra saugomas jungties autentifikavimo kredencialas , pvz., OAuth jungties kredencialai SharePoint .

Ryšio nuoroda yra sprendimo komponentas, kuriame yra nuoroda į ryšį apie konkrečią jungtį. Tiek prie sprendimo prisitaikančios drobės programos, tiek prie sprendimo prisitaikančio srauto operacijos susiejamos su ryšio nuoroda, o ne tiesiogiai su ryšiu. Importuojant sprendimą į paskirties aplinką, visoms ryšio nuorodoms suteikiamas ryšys, kad užbaigus importavimą būtų galima automatiškai įjungti visus nuorodų srautus. Tam, kad pakeistumėte konkretų ryšį susietą su drobės programa ar eiga, redaguojate ryšio nuorodos komponentą sprendime.

Ryšio nuorodų įtraukimas į sprendimą

Ryšio nuorodas į sprendimą galima įtraukti įvairiais būdais:

  • Kai naudojate sprendimų naršyklę, kad sukurtumėte naują ryšio nuorodą sprendime.

  • Kai importuojate sprendimą. Norėdami sužinoti daugiau, eikite į Sprendimų importavimas.

  • Netiesiogiai, kai kuriate drobės programas ir srautus , kurie yra apibrėžti Microsoft Dataverse sprendime.

Pastaba.

  • Drobės programos ir eigos tvarko ryšius skirtingai. Srautai naudoja visų jungčių ryšio nuorodas, o drobės programos jas naudoja tik netiesiogiai bendrinamiems (neOAuth)ryšiams, pvz., SQL serverio autentifikavimui. Daugiau informacijos: Sauga ir autentifikavimo tipai
  • Ryšio nuoroda automatiškai sukuriama, kai kuriate naujus ryšius iš srauto dizaino įrankio arba Power Apps Studio.
  • Drobės programos ir srautai, įtraukti iš išorinių sprendimų, nebus automatiškai atnaujinti, kad būtų galima naudoti ryšio nuorodas.
  • Ryšių nuorodos susiejamos su drobės programomis tik tada, kai duomenų šaltinis įtraukiamas į programą. Norėdami atnaujinti programas, turite pašalinti ryšį iš programos ir tada įtraukti ryšį, kuriame yra susieta ryšio nuoroda.

Ryšio nuorodos įtraukimas rankiniu būdu naudojant sprendimų naršyklę

  1. Prisijunkite prie Power Apps OR Power Automate.

  2. Kairėje juostoje pasirinkite Sprendimai. Jei elemento nėra šoninio skydelio srityje, pasirinkite ... Daugiau ir pasirinkite norimą elementą.

  3. Sukurkite naują ar atverkite esantį sprendimą.

  4. Komandų juostoje pasirinkite Nauja>daugiau>ryšio nuoroda.

  5. Srityje Nauja ryšio nuoroda įveskite šią informaciją. Būtini stulpeliai yra pažymėti žvaigždute (*).

    • Rodomas pavadinimas: įveskite unikalų ir naudingą pavadinimą, kad būtų lengviau atskirti šią ryšio nuorodą nuo kitų.
    • Įtraukite aprašą: įveskite ryšį, aprašantį tekstą.
    • Jungtis: iš sąrašo pasirinkite esamą jungtį, pvz., čia esančioje ekrano kopijoje. Taip pat galite pasirinkti Naujas , kad sukurtumėte naują ryšį šiai ryšio nuorodai. Baigę kurti naują ryšį, pasirinkite Atnaujinti , kad pasirinktumėte ryšį iš sąrašo.
    • Ryšys: pagal pasirinktą jungtį pasirinkite esamą ryšį arba pasirinkite Naujas ryšys , kad jį sukurtumėte.
  6. Pasirinkite Kurti.

    Skydo Nauja ryšio nuoroda ekrano nuotrauka.

Pavadinimo suteikimas ryšio nuorodai

Ryšio nuorodos rodomas pavadinimas turi būti unikalus, kad skirtingas ryšio nuorodas būtų galima atskirti pagal pavadinimą. Pagal numatytuosius nustatymus ryšio nuorodos pavadinimas apima paskirties jungtį, dabartinį konteksto sprendimo pavadinimą ir atsitiktinį priesagą, kad būtų užtikrintas unikalumas. Galite koreguoti ryšio nuorodos pavadinimą ir sukurti unikalų ir jos paskirtį nurodantį pavadinimą.

Pakartotinis jungčių naudojimas sprendimo sraute

Srautai, sukurti ne sprendime, tiesiogiai naudoja ryšius. Sprendime sukurti srautai naudoja ryšio nuorodas ir ryšio nuorodos taškus prie ryšio. Norėdami iš naujo naudoti ryšį sprendimų sraute, pirmiausia turite sukurti ryšio nuorodą, nurodančią į tą ryšį.

Srauto naujinimas, kad vietoj ryšių būtų naudojamos ryšio nuorodos

Kai srauto nėra sprendime, jis naudoja ryšius. Jei tas srautas bus įtrauktas į tirpalą, jis iš pradžių ir toliau naudos jungtis. Srautus galima atnaujinti, kad būtų galima naudoti ryšių nuorodas, o ne ryšius vienu iš dviejų būdu:

  1. Jei srautas eksportuojamas į nevaldomąjį sprendimą ir importuojamas, ryšiai bus pašalinti ir pakeisti ryšio nuorodomis.

  2. Atidarius sprendimo srautą, srauto tikrintuvas srauto informacijos puslapyje parodys įspėjimą Naudoti ryšio nuorodas. Įspėjimo pranešime yra veiksmas Pašalinti ryšius, kad būtų galima įtraukti ryšio nuorodas. Pasirinkus tą veiksmą, iš paleidiklio ir srauto veiksmų bus pašalinti ryšiai ir bus leidžiama pasirinkti bei kurti ryšio nuorodas.

Automatinis ryšio nuorodų naudojimas sprendimų sraute

Kai veiksmas įtraukiamas į sprendimo srautą, Power Automate prieš kuriant naują ryšio nuorodą, bus bandoma pakartotinai naudoti esamas ryšio nuorodas iš dabartinio sprendimo ar kitų sprendimų. Norėdami užtikrinti, kad ryšio nuoroda yra tame pačiame sprendime kaip ir srautas, sukurkite arba įtraukite to paties sprendimo ryšio nuorodą ir nuorodą, kurią nurodo ryšio nuoroda iš srauto.

Bendrinkite ryšius su kitu vartotoju, kad būtų galima įjungti srautus

Kai srautas įjungtas (įjungtas), srautą įjungiantis vartotojas turi turėti arba turėti leidimą naudoti visas srauto jungtis. Tai paprastai pasiekiama, kai srauto savininkas sukuria ryšius visose ryšių nuorodose, kurias naudoja eiga. Jei naudotojas, kuris nėra srauto savininkas, pateikia srauto jungtis, tada srautą turi įjungti tų jungčių savininkas arba ryšiai turi būti bendrinami su vartotoju, kuris įjungia srautą.

Pastaba.

OAuth ryšiai gali būti aiškiai bendrinami tik su vartotoju, atstovaujančiu paslaugos vykdytojui.

Rankinis jungčių bendrinimas srauto įgalinimui

Bendrinti ryšius galima atlikus šiuos veiksmus.

  1. Eikite į Power Apps ir pasirinkite aplinką, kurioje yra ryšys.

  2. Kairiojoje naršymo srityje pasirinkite Ryšiai , tada pasirinkite ryšį, kurį norite bendrinti. Jei elemento nėra šoninio skydelio srityje, pasirinkite ... Daugiau ir pasirinkite norimą elementą.

  3. Meniu pasirinkite Bendrinti.

  4. Bendrinimo ekrane įveskite vartotojo (paslaugos vykdytojo), kuris įgalins srautą, vardą.

  5. Norėdami gauti leidimus, pasirinkite Gali naudoti.

  6. Norėdami užbaigti bendrinimą, pasirinkite Įrašyti.

Automatinis ryšių bendrinimas srauto įgalinimui

Norėdami automatizuoti ryšių bendrinimą, naudokite veiksmą Redaguoti ryšio vaidmens priskyrimą, esantį Power Apps jungtyje Makers.

Ryšio bendrinimo pavyzdžio ekrano nuotrauka.

Apribojimai

  • Ryšio nuorodos dabar įrašomos asinchroniškai. Kitaip nei peržiūros laikotarpiu, nebėra apribojimo, kiek srautų gali nurodyti tą pačią ryšio nuorodą. Kai atnaujinamos ryšio nuorodos, rodoma informacinė reklamjuostė, susiejanti su skydeliu, kuriame yra asinchroninio naujinimo informacija.
  • Taip pat neribojamas kiekvieno srauto veiksmų, kuriuos galima susieti su ryšio nuoroda, skaičius.
  • Drobės programos neatpažįsta ryšio nuorodų pasirinktinėse jungtyse. Norint apeiti šį apribojimą, importavus sprendimą į aplinką, programą reikia redaguoti, kad būtų pašalinta, ir tada perskaityti pasirinktinį jungties ryšį. Atminkite, kad jei ši programa yra valdomame sprendime, toliau redaguojant programą bus sukurtas nevaldomas sluoksnis. Daugiau informacijos: Sprendimo sluoksniai

Žinomos problemos

Šiame skyriuje aprašomos žinomos problemos, susijusios su ryšio nuorodomis.

Kopijuoti aplinką nutraukia pasirinktinių jungčių ryšio nuorodas

Pasirinktinės jungtys naudoja konkrečios aplinkos identifikatorių, kad nurodytų pasirinktinę jungtį. Atlikus kopijavimo aplinkos operaciją, reikia sukurti naują ryšio nuorodą į naują pasirinktinę jungtį. Tada reikės pataisyti visas programas ar srautus, naudojančius senas ryšio nuorodas.

Pasirinktines jungtis reikia importuoti atskiru sprendimu iš jų prijungimo nuorodų

Pasirinktines jungtis reikia importuoti atskirame sprendime, prieš prijungiant nuorodas ar srautus. Pirmiausia eksportuokite sprendimą , kuriame yra tik pasirinktinė jungtis.

DUK

Kaip ištaisyti klaidą "Netinkamas ryšys"?

Jei ryšio nuoroda rodoma kaip "neteisinga", kai srauto informacijos puslapyje rodomas raudonas šauktukas, tai reiškia, kad pagrindinis ryšys yra blogos būsenos. Kai taip nutinka, patikrinkite ir pataisykite pagrindinį ryšį atnaujindami ryšį arba pakeiskite ryšį.

Kas yra "ConnectionAuthorizationFailed" klaida? Kodėl negaliu įjungti (suaktyvinti) srauto?

Klaida "ConnectionAuthorizationFailed" rodo, kad vartotojas, bandantis suaktyvinti srautą, neturi teisių bent vienam iš ryšių, kuriuos naudoja srautas. Norėdami išspręsti situaciją, pasirinkite vieną iš šių sprendimų:

  • Vartotojai, kuriems priklauso ryšiai, turi dalytis visais ryšiais su vartotoju, įjungiančiu (suaktyvinančiu) srautą.
  • Jei visi srauto ryšiai priklauso vienam vartotojui, tas vartotojas gali įjungti (suaktyvinti) srautą.

Kai ryšių savininkas įjungia srautą, srautas turi leidimus naudoti tuos ryšius. Nuo to momento bet kuris srauto bendrasavininkis gali įjungti srautą.

Ar srautą gali įjungti jo ryšių savininkas, o tada nuosavybės teisė gali būti perduota kitam vartotojui?

Taip. Kai srautą įjungia (įjungia) srauto naudojamų jungčių savininkas, srautas gauna aiškų leidimą naudoti tuos ryšius. Tada srauto bendrasavininkiai gali išjungti ir įjungti srautą, jei reikia.

Leidimai, suteikti programoms ir srautams naudojant ryšį, gali būti matomi to ryšio išsamios informacijos puslapyje, esančiame skirtukuose Programos, naudojančios šį ryšį , ir Srautai naudojant šį ryšį .

Jei srautas redaguojamas norint pridėti naujų veiksmų, kurie naudoja papildomas ryšio nuorodas su naujais ryšiais, tų naujų ryšių savininkas turi arba iš pradžių pats įjungti srautą, arba bendrinti ryšius su savininku, kuris įjungia srautą. Daugiau informacijos: Taikomųjų programų išteklių bendrinimas

Ar ryšio nuorodos nuosavybės teisė gali būti perduota kitam vartotojui?

Ryšio nuorodos nuosavybės teisės negalima perduoti kitam vartotojui iš srities Power Apps Sprendimai (make.powerapps.com).

Tačiau klasikinę sprendimų naršyklę galima naudoti norint pakeisti ryšio nuorodos teises, įskaitant bendrinimą.

Taip pat žr.

Jungtys